大家好,欢迎来到IT知识分享网。
目录
前言
人生苦短,我用Python!又是新的一周啦,本期博主给大家带来了一个全新的作品:满屏表白代码,无限弹窗版!快快收藏起来送给她吧~
完整代码见:Python满屏表白代码
系列文章
序号 | 文章目录 | 直达链接 | |
表白系列 | |||
1 | 无法拒绝的表白界面 | Python满屏表白代码 | |
2 | 满屏飘字表白代码 | Python满屏表白代码 | |
3 | 无限弹窗表白代码 | Python满屏表白代码 | |
4 | 李峋同款可写字版跳动的爱心 | Python满屏表白代码 | |
5 | 流星雨 | Python满屏表白代码 | |
6 | 漂浮爱心 | Python满屏表白代码 | |
7 | 爱心光波 | Python满屏表白代码 | |
8 | 玫瑰花 | Python满屏表白代码 | |
节日系列 | |||
1 | 新春/跨年 | 烟花秀(2022) | Python满屏表白代码 |
烟花秀(2023) | Python满屏表白代码 | ||
粒子烟花 | Python满屏表白代码 | ||
2 | 圣诞节 | 圣诞礼物 | Python满屏表白代码 |
圣诞树(2022) | Python满屏表白代码 | ||
绿色圣诞树(2023) | Python满屏表白代码 | ||
粉色圣诞树(2023) | Python满屏表白代码 | ||
3 | 冬至 | 大雪纷飞 | Python满屏表白代码 |
4 | 生日 | 生日蛋糕 | Python满屏表白代码 |
5 | 儿童节 | 五彩气球 | Python满屏表白代码 |
6 | 国庆节 | 国庆祝福 | Python满屏表白代码 |
7 | 万圣节 | 万圣礼物 | Python满屏表白代码 |
8 | 愚人节 | 愚人代码 | Python满屏表白代码 |
9 | 中秋节 | 浪漫星空 | Python满屏表白代码 |
10 | 植树节 | 樱花树 | Python满屏表白代码 |
动漫系列 | |||
1 | 名侦探柯南系列 | 柯南 | Python满屏表白代码 |
2 | 喜羊羊与灰太狼系列 | 喜羊羊 | Python满屏表白代码 |
懒羊羊 | Python满屏表白代码 | ||
灰太狼 | Python满屏表白代码 | ||
小灰灰 | Python满屏表白代码 | ||
小香香 | Python满屏表白代码 | ||
3 | 海绵宝宝系列 | 海绵宝宝 | Python满屏表白代码 |
4 | 哆啦A梦系列 | 哆啦A梦 | Python满屏表白代码 |
5 | HelloKitty系列 | hellokitty | Python满屏表白代码 |
6 | Tom&Jerry系列 | Tom&Jerry | Python满屏表白代码 |
7 | 草莓熊系列 | 草莓熊 | Python满屏表白代码 |
8 | 皮卡丘系列 | 迷你皮卡丘 | Python满屏表白代码 |
高级皮卡丘 | Python满屏表白代码 | ||
豪华皮卡丘 | Python满屏表白代码 | ||
炫酷系列 | |||
1 | 一闪一闪亮星星系列 | 张万森下雪了 | Python满屏表白代码 |
一闪一闪亮星星 | Python满屏表白代码 | ||
2 | 代码雨 | Python满屏表白代码 | |
3 | 七彩花朵 | Python满屏表白代码 | |
4 | 3D星空 | Python满屏表白代码 | |
5 | 金榜题名 | Python满屏表白代码 | |
6 | 满天星 | Python满屏表白代码 | |
…… |
爱心界面
程序设计
def Heart(): root=tk.Tk() screenwidth=root.winfo_screenwidth() screenheight=root.winfo_screenheight() width=600 height=400 x=(screenwidth-width)//2 y=(screenheight-height)//2 root.title("❤") root.geometry("%dx%d+%d+%d"%(screenwidth,screenheight,0,0)) tk.Label(root,text='❤',fg='pink',bg='white',font=("Comic Sans MS",500),width=300,height=20).pack() root.mainloop()
程序分析
这是一个使用Python的Tkinter库创建窗口的程序,该程序会在屏幕中央显示一个红色的心形图案。程序首先导入了Tkinter库,并定义了一个名为Heart的函数。在函数中,程序定义了一个Tk窗口对象,并获取了当前屏幕的宽度和高度。接着程序定义了窗口的宽度和高度,并计算了窗口在屏幕中的位置。程序设置了窗口的标题为”❤”,并且使用geometry方法将窗口的大小和位置设置为占据整个屏幕。程序使用一个Label标签对象将一个大号的红色心形文本添加到窗口中,并使其在屏幕中央居中。最后,程序进入Tkinter的事件循环中,以响应用户的输入和操作。
无限弹窗
程序设计
def Love1(): root=tk.Tk() width=200 height=50 screenwidth=root.winfo_screenwidth() screenheight=root.winfo_screenheight() x=ra.randint(0,screenwidth/2) y=ra.randint(0,screenheight/2) root.title("❤") root.geometry("%dx%d+%d+%d"%(width,height,x,y)) tk.Label(root,text='I LOVE YOU!',fg='white',bg='pink',font=("Comic Sans MS",15),width=30,height=5).pack() root.mainloop() ……
程序分析
这是一个简单的Python程序,用于在屏幕上显示一个窗口,其中包含一个粉色背景和一个白色文本,显示”I LOVE YOU!”这个信息。它有四个不同的位置,可以随机出现在屏幕的四个角落,使得每次显示的位置都是随机的。
程序采用了Python的GUI库Tkinter来实现窗口的创建和显示。在函数Love1,Love2,Love3和Love4中,首先创建一个Tk对象root,并设置窗口的宽度和高度。然后使用屏幕的宽度和高度来随机生成x和y坐标,这些坐标是窗口位置的依据。然后设置窗口的标题,使用geometry()方法设置窗口的宽度,高度和位置。在窗口中添加一个Label小部件来显示文本内容,最后运行主循环。
程序中使用了Python内置的random库来生成随机数,用于在屏幕上显示不同位置的窗口。程序的文本信息使用了Comic Sans MS字体,显示在粉色的背景上,使得窗口看起来很温馨。
这个程序比较简单,但是它通过创建窗口并在其中显示文本信息的方式,来表达一种浪漫的情感。它可以用于不同场景,比如展示在情人节、纪念日等特殊的日子里,传达爱的信息。此外,程序的代码也比较短,容易理解和修改。
完整代码
Python满屏表白代码
尾声
祝天下有情人终成眷属!
免责声明:本站所有文章内容,图片,视频等均是来源于用户投稿和互联网及文摘转载整编而成,不代表本站观点,不承担相关法律责任。其著作权各归其原作者或其出版社所有。如发现本站有涉嫌抄袭侵权/违法违规的内容,侵犯到您的权益,请在线联系站长,一经查实,本站将立刻删除。 本文来自网络,若有侵权,请联系删除,如若转载,请注明出处:https://haidsoft.com/156346.html